gpt4 book ai didi

javascript - XSLT 和 XPATH 在现代浏览器中的情况如何?

转载 作者:数据小太阳 更新时间:2023-10-29 04:46:53 24 4
gpt4 key购买 nike

我正在编写 javascript 代码来遍历和操作深度嵌套的 XML 文档。对于现代浏览器,是否仍然需要像这样的跨浏览器库:

据我所知,如果不使用其中之一,在禁用 ActiveX 的 IE 中将不会有任何 XPath。 XSLT 和 XPath 都需要一个简单的包装器来区分 IE 和 w3c XML Dom。

最佳答案

只要您坚持使用 XSLT 1.0 功能,我会说 XSL 和 XPATH 支持在所有浏览器上都运行良好,甚至可以追溯到 IE6。

话虽这么说,但客户端 XSLT 处理中有足够多的烦恼(包括直到最近 firefox 中针对使用客户端 XSLT 生成的文件的可怕的 JQuery 错误),不值得您花时间。

我在 2009 年的大部分时间里都在努力研究这个主题,但我看不出有什么好的理由在客户端进行处理,而在服务器上进行处理同样容易。如果您必须提供 XML,请允许客户端使用查询字符串变量或 Accept: header 专门请求它。

关于javascript - XSLT 和 XPATH 在现代浏览器中的情况如何?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2275791/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com